Web前端(html/css/javascript)
文章平均质量分 70
ewolfyu
这个作者很懒,什么都没留下…
展开
-
使用iframe在网页中嵌入复杂表格
有些excel表格、有很多rowspan、colspan,而且格式非常多。如果直接在html中手工实现,将花费很多时间。一种快速的解决方案是:将excel中需要展示的表格拷贝到word中,再保存成htm格式,再嵌入到iframe中。这样可以在不破坏原有页面格式的情况下展现复杂的excel内容。原创 2012-03-31 19:35:59 · 2723 阅读 · 0 评论 -
Javascript hack
以下是工作中实际遇到的问题,供也遇到的同学参考。1、扩展IE下数组的indexOf方法对数组的indexOf是一个基本操作,但IE却不支持。需要使用时,可以用以下代码增加此方法if (!Array.indexOf) { Array.prototype.indexOf = function(obj) { for (var i = 0; i < this.l原创 2012-04-09 11:35:06 · 858 阅读 · 0 评论 -
CSS 经验教训 & IE HACKs
1、表格在IE下最外层边框无颜色。 table td, table th { border-color: blue; } 解决办法:对table本身也要设置颜色table, table td, table th { border-color: blue; } 2、字体显示不正常。代码:h5 { font-family: Arial, 微软雅黑;} 在IE中原创 2012-03-31 19:38:08 · 500 阅读 · 0 评论 -
jQuery的一些用法
使用 $("td:nth-child(even)")可以隔一个选中。类似的还有::nth-child(even):nth-child(odd):nth-child(3n):nth-child(2):nth-child(3n+1):nth-child(3n+2)这样可以实现隔任意选中原创 2012-03-31 19:31:41 · 364 阅读 · 0 评论 -
控制“li”列表折行时是否对齐
通过list-style-position属性来控制。outside时将对齐,inside时第二行将顶格。如下。 牛奶牛奶牛奶牛奶牛奶牛奶牛奶牛奶牛牛奶牛奶牛奶牛奶牛奶牛奶牛奶牛奶牛奶牛牛奶原创 2012-03-31 19:34:19 · 630 阅读 · 0 评论 -
各浏览器navigator.userAgent实例
做了一个统计访问者浏览器的功能,上报了浏览器的navigator.userAgent信息。以下是用本机的各浏览器做的实验,供日后参考 【firefox】Mozilla/5.0 (Windows NT 5.1; rv:8.0.1) Gecko/20100101 Firefox/8.0.1【chrome】Mozilla/5.0 (Windows NT 5.1) AppleW原创 2012-03-31 19:43:32 · 1531 阅读 · 0 评论 -
一次AJAX跨域访问无响应 解决过程
在A网站使用jQuery .post 向自己网站发送请求,OK。在B网站向A网站发请求时,fireBug报错,但没有显示错误原因。1、在网上搜索可能是“javascript跨域访问”的问题。2、在A网站设置断点,能够收到B网站的请求,也返回了响应,但B网页上跟踪却没有收到。3、网上说post不支持跨域,于是将.post换成.get,问题依然4、网上说datatype为json时原创 2012-03-31 19:50:11 · 1489 阅读 · 1 评论 -
浏览器不能访问本地资源的限制
做一个截图上传的功能,想在上传前在网页中显示预览,发现做不到。原因:html,js不能直接访问本地资源,否则存在严重的安全隐患。类似的还有,js不能设置input:file中的值今天了解到,这个叫做“客户端编程语言”的同源策略。同源策略规定跨域之间的脚本是隔离的,一个域的脚本不能访问和操作另外一个域的绝大部分属性和方法。相同域要具有相同的协议(如http), 相同的原创 2012-03-31 19:30:54 · 5902 阅读 · 0 评论 -
javascript 表格转excel、设置选中区域、拷贝到剪贴板尝试
表格转excel做一个项目时,会产生一个很大的表格,为方便使用,想提供一个按钮,将table导成excel。1、最可行的方案是通过服务器重新生成这个表格,提供给用户下载。2、网上流传可能用javascript将table导成excel,但因为“安全性、浏览器兼容性因素”等导致基本不可用。 javaScript设置选中区域1、对于textbox可以使用下面的方原创 2012-03-31 19:49:09 · 964 阅读 · 0 评论 -
jQuery源码阅读有感
这段时间工作上需要经常用到jQuery,出于崇拜和好奇心,粗略的阅读了下jQuery的源码。这其中参考了 nuysoft同学写的《jQuery1.6.1源码分析系列》读完源码只感觉了解了大概。1、javascript做为弱类型语言,很灵活,源码不容易懂2、jQuery为了简洁,代码中大量应用三元表达式、链式布尔表达式、等等,代码的确很精湛,但读起来真的蛋疼3、j原创 2012-09-20 10:59:56 · 476 阅读 · 0 评论